Tycoons Worldwide Group Public Company Limited,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and distributes steel wire rods, steel annealing wires, reinforced concrete bars, steel screws, and wire products in Thailand. Tycoons Worldwide Group Public Company Limited is a subsidiary of Tycoons Group International Co., Ltd. The company has 596.75 M outstanding shares. More on Tycoons Worldwide Group

Tycoons Worldwide Group (TYCN) is traded on Thailand Exchange in Thailand and employs 17 people. The company currently falls under 'Mid-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 1.66 B. Market capitalization usually refers to the total value of a company's stock within the entire market. To calculate Tycoons Worldwide's market, we take the total number of its shares issued and multiply it by Tycoons Worldwide's current market price. To manage market risk and economic uncertainty, many investors today build portfolios that are diversified across equities with different market capitalizations. However, as a general rule, conservative investors tend to hold large-cap stocks, and those looking for more risk prefer small-cap and mid-cap equities. Tycoons Worldwide operates under Metals & Mining sector and is part of Materials industry. The entity has 596.75 M outstanding shares. Tycoons Worldwide Group has accumulated about 491.03 M in cash with (87.07 M) of positive cash flow from operations. This results in cash-per-share (CPS) ratio of 0.82.
